Breaking Down Climate Trends
Let’s take a look at April’s climate statistics for the metro Atlanta area. The average temperature in April was significantly higher than normal. For example, on April 17, the max temperature hit 90°F, which was 13.5°F above average. During this month, precipitation was mostly absent, with many days recording no rain at all.
Climate trends indicate that higher-than-normal temperatures are becoming more common. According to the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ration, the past few decades have seen a consistent rise in average temperatures across the Southeast. This trend can impact everything from local ecosystems to agriculture.

What Does the National Weather Service Do?
The National Weather Service (NWS) is essential for weather predictions and warnings. They provide forecasts that help keep people safe and informed. The NWS aims to create a “Weather-Ready Nation,” ensuring that communities are prepared for any weather events.
The services they offer include observing weather conditions, issuing warnings, and providing education to the public. The goal is to minimize risks and enhance safety in all weather scenarios.
